WebQuick tip 1 Don’t take the lying personally. Try to remember that when kids with ADHD lie, they’re usually not trying to defy or disrespect you. They may be struggling with doing a sequence of tasks or with impulsivity. Quick tip 2 Remove the shame of lying. Don’t excuse the lie, but show that you understand that something led to it. WebFeb 4, 2024 · Compulsive teen lying involves consistent, ongoing lies. Teens lie compulsively as a way to control what their parents know about their lives.
